Dress for Success: A Guide to Professional Attire in Business
When entering the corporate world, your attire can significantly impact first views. It's essential to grasp the unspoken rules of professional dress to demonstrate competence and confidence in your abilities. A well-chosen wardrobe can strengthen your credibility and help you succeed in a competitive setting.
Here are some essential principles to guide you:
* **Opt for classic, timeless pieces:** Instead of chasing fleeting trends, invest in versatile garments that transcend seasonal changes.
* **Choose fabrics with quality and structure:** Natural fibers like wool, cotton, or silk convey sophistication and durability. Refrain from materials that are too casual or easily wrinkled.
* **Pay attention to fit and tailoring:** Clothes should be well-fitted but not restrictive. A professional appearance often involves tailored pieces that emphasize your figure in a flattering way.
